New Mexico will become the 24th state to decriminalize marijuana. On Wednesday, Gov. Michelle Lujan Grisham signed a bill that would reduce the penalties for anyone found in possession of marijuana, starting July 1. Lil Nas X’s “Old Town Road” has reignited a longstanding debate about what “real” country music sounds and looks like. Harvard officials have launched an independent investigation into a sweetheart property deal involving a student’s parent and the head coach of Harvard’s fencing team. The probe is taking place amid a nationwide college admissions bribery scandal, in which 33 parents have been charged with bribing officials and falsifying test scores to ensure their children gained admissions into top universities.
